Tamim Fahed نشر 30 يوليو 2021 أرسل تقرير مشاركة نشر 30 يوليو 2021 (معدل) أحاول إيجاد طريقة لإنشاء والكتابة على ملف نصي من خلال node.js مباشرةً أي من ضمن الكود البرمجي. كيف يمكنني تنفيذ ذلك؟ وماهي الحزمة التي يجب أن أقوم باستخدامها؟ تم التعديل في 30 يوليو 2021 بواسطة Tamim Fahed 1 ا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
1 Yomna Raouf نشر 30 يوليو 2021 أرسل تقرير مشاركة نشر 30 يوليو 2021 يمكنك القيام بذلك عن طريق File System API و هو عبارة عن module جاهز في node/js: لاحظ المثال التلي: const fs = require('fs'); fs.writeFile("/tmp/test", "Hey there!", function(err) { if(err) { return console.log(err); } console.log("The file was saved!"); }); أو const fs = require('fs'); fs.writeFileSync('/tmp/test-sync', 'Hey there!'); 1 ا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
1 عبدالباسط ابراهيم نشر 30 يوليو 2021 أرسل تقرير مشاركة نشر 30 يوليو 2021 بالطبع يمكنك من خلال ال File System API كما في التعليق السابق وتم استخدام ال writeFile وتوجد طريقة أخرى وهي createWriteStream بحيث يمكنك الكتابة عدة مرات في الملف وإنهاء ال stream بعد الإنتها كالتالي var fs = require('fs'); var stream = fs.createWriteStream("file.txt"); stream.once('open', function(fd) { stream.write(" first row\n"); stream.write(" second row\n"); stream.end(); }); ا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
0 MoJaffer نشر 1 أغسطس 2021 أرسل تقرير مشاركة نشر 1 أغسطس 2021 (معدل) تسطيع ذلك بسهولة بإستخدام fs const fs = require('fs') const content = 'Some Content' fs.writeFile('./test.txt', content, err => { if (err) { console.error(err) return } console.log('تم الكتابة بنجاح'); }) تم التعديل في 1 أغسطس 2021 بواسطة MoJaffer اقتباس رابط هذا التعليق شارك على الشبكات الإجتماعية More sharing options...
السؤال
Tamim Fahed
أحاول إيجاد طريقة لإنشاء والكتابة على ملف نصي من خلال node.js مباشرةً أي من ضمن الكود البرمجي. كيف يمكنني تنفيذ ذلك؟ وماهي الحزمة التي يجب أن أقوم باستخدامها؟
تم التعديل في بواسطة Tamim Fahedرابط هذا التعليق
شارك على الشبكات الإجتماعية
3 أجوبة على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.